29990851 spelling in english words
twenty-nine million, nine hundred ninety thousand, eight hundred fifty-one
Learn how to write spell 29990851 ( twenty-nine million nine hundred ninety thousand eight hundred fifty-one ) in uk british english words. Convert number to words for 29990851. spelling of 29990851 in words.
Currency £29990851 in british english: twenty-nine million, nine hundred ninety thousand, eight hundred fifty-one Pound.
In Price: 29990851.00
28990851 | 30990851